Bill Summary

AN ACT to provide an appropriation for defraying the expenses of the public service commission; to amend and reenact sections 49-01-05 and 57-43.2-19 of the North Dakota Century Code, relating to the salaries of the public service commissioners and deposits of special fuels excise taxes; and to provide loan authorization.

AI Summary

This bill provides comprehensive funding and regulatory updates for the North Dakota Public Service Commission (PSC) for the 2025-2027 biennium. The bill includes an appropriation of approximately $23.5 million, with about $9.2 million coming from the general fund, to cover the PSC's operational expenses, including salaries, operating costs, capital assets, grants, and specialized programs like the abandoned mined lands services and railroad safety program. The bill authorizes the PSC to obtain a loan up to $900,000 from the Bank of North Dakota for a rail rate complaint case, with repayment contingent on potential damages or proceeds from a successful outcome. Additionally, the bill increases the annual salary of public service commissioners from $130,000 to $139,256 through June 30, 2026, and to $143,434 thereafter. The legislation also modifies the transfer of special fuels excise taxes collected from railroad diesel fuel sales, increasing the amount transferred to the rail safety fund from $332,327 to $352,892 per year. The bill includes provisions for one-time funding items like drone imaging technology and federal intervention funding, which will be reported to the legislative assembly for future budget considerations.
